Understanding Reverse Osmosis Treatment Technology
If your water tests high for uranium, one of the most effective treatment technologies available is reverse osmosis (RO). This method uses a semipermeable membrane to remove contaminants from water, including heavy metals like uranium. With RO systems, water is forced through the membrane, allowing only clean, safe water to pass through while trapping impurities.
Sizing Your Reverse Osmosis System
When considering an RO system for your home, sizing is an important factor. Homeowners need to evaluate their water usage to determine the right system for their needs. Key factors to consider include:
- Flow Rate: Measured in gallons per minute (GPM), it's essential to choose a system that can deliver adequate pressure and flow for your household needs.
- Grain Capacity: This refers to the system's ability to remove contaminants over time and can help determine how often the filters need to be changed.
- Gallons Per Day (GPD): This metric indicates how much purified water the system can produce daily. Ensure you select a model that accommodates your household's drinking water requirements.
- Tank Size: The tank size must match your consumption to avoid running out of filtered water during peak usage times.
Maintenance Needs of Reverse Osmosis Systems
To ensure optimal performance, regular maintenance of RO systems is crucial. Here’s what to keep in mind:
- Filter Changes: Depending on usage and water quality, filters typically need to be replaced every 6 to 12 months.
- Membrane Replacement: The semipermeable membrane may need to be replaced every 2 to 5 years, depending on the system and the quality of water being treated.
- Cleaning: Regularly inspect and clean the tank and system parts according to the manufacturer's guidelines to prevent biofilm buildup.

Understanding Water Pressure
Water pressure plays a crucial role in the performance of a reverse osmosis (RO) system. Systems require a certain level of pressure to function efficiently. Low water pressure can lead to a slower filtration process and decreased water production. Homeowners should assess their water pressure before installation, and if necessary, consider a booster pump to enhance system performance.
Pre-Filtration Stages
Many RO systems include pre-filtration stages to increase water quality and protect the membrane. These filters typically consist of:
- Sediment Filter: This filter traps larger particles such as dirt, rust, and sand, preventing them from clogging the membrane.
- Carbon Filter: This stage removes chlorine and other chemicals that can damage the semipermeable membrane.
Incorporating effective pre-filtration can extend the life of the RO system and improve overall water quality.
